Output 95ad3755ce19eba231e2ff27e6e894cddd4d51f76dcf329d140194e4e223a578:5

value
11716698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e62162ecb54b7444a71e0f7a140056ba7b9d69 OP_EQUAL
address
MM7KDo5tDZUKUJgFLaoNgbzPmecu8m3v9K
transaction
95ad3755ce19eba231e2ff27e6e894cddd4d51f76dcf329d140194e4e223a578
spent
true